What is arcminute?

The arcminute (′) equals 1/60 of a degree. It is used in astronomy for measuring celestial positions, in navigation for coordinates, and in optics for describing visual acuity.

What is arcsecond?

The arcsecond (″) equals 1/60 of an arcminute or 1/3,600 of a degree. It is used in astronomy for measuring star positions, in geodesy for precise coordinates, and in telescope specifications.

How to convert arcmin to arcsec

To convert Arcminute to Arcsecond, multiply the value by 60.
